The factors contributing to the failure of underground water distribution pipes are multifaceted. These pipes, responsible for delivering potable water to homes and businesses, are susceptible to a variety of stresses and deteriorating influences that can ultimately lead to breaches in their structural integrity. These failures manifest as leaks, cracks, or complete ruptures, disrupting water service and often causing significant property damage.
Understanding the etiology of these failures is crucial for effective infrastructure management and proactive preventative maintenance. Accurate diagnosis of the underlying causes enables municipalities and water utilities to implement targeted strategies for extending the lifespan of their water distribution networks, minimizing service interruptions, and reducing the economic burden associated with repairs. Historically, a reactive approach to water main maintenance prevailed; however, increasing awareness of the long-term consequences of neglecting infrastructure has spurred a shift toward more proactive and data-driven maintenance programs.
